Abstract:Polyhydroxyalkanoates (PHA) are environmentally friendly polymers produced by many bacteria under nutrientlimited conditions. However, their commercialization is hindered by production expenses. The present study aimed at cost-effective and efficient production of poly(3-hydroxybutyrate) (PHB) by Bacillus (B.) cereus isolate CCASU-P83.
